`Enumerable#sum` is optimized for integer ranges. Unfortunately, this can break subclasses:
```ruby
class StepTwoRange < Range
def each(&block)
step(2, &block)
end
end
r = StepTwoRange.new(0, 10)
r.to_a #=> [0, 2, 4, 6, 8, 10]
r.to_a.sum #=> 30
r.sum #=> 55
```
The optimization should therefore only be triggered for instances of `Range` and not for instances of subclasses.
If this behavior is intentional, it should at least be documented.
